SYDNEY, Feb. 3 -- Zinc concentrate production has resumed at Australia's Century zinc mine after being suspended last week due to a tropical storm, the mine's owner, Minmetals said on Wednesday.
Ore mining was not interrupted but concentrate output stopped on Jan 26 as the storm threatened the port of Karumba where the material is loaded on ships for export to smelters.
The Century mine is the world's second largest of its kind and produces about 500,000 tonnes of zinc, a third of Australia's total production, from 1 million tonnes of concentrate annually.
